a.tags-link.selected, span.tags-link.selected  {
    background: var(--blue-light);
    color: #fff;
    border-color: var(--blue-light);
}

.container .catalog-content .diff_complect .row {
    width: 100%
}

.content .catalog-content  .card-group-list-img .card-group-product .diff_complect .card .card-body .diff_prices .action {
    position: static;
}

.container .catalog-content .diff_complect .card .sale {
    height: 25%;
}
 .container .catalog-content .content .card-group-list-img .diff_complect .sale {
    margin-top: 0px;
    margin-right: 0px;
}
.content .catalog-content  .card-group-list-img .card-group-product .diff_complect .card {
    padding: 15px 30px 15px;
}
  .content .catalog-content  .card-group-list-img .card-group-product .diff_complect .card .card-body .diff_prices {
    flex-flow: row ;
    display: flex ;
    justify-content: space-evenly;
}
.content .catalog-content  .card-group-list-img .card-group-product .diff_complect .card .card-body .wrapper-price-btn {
    width: 40%
}

@media screen and (max-width: 766px)  {
    .content .catalog-content  .card-group-list-img .card-group-product .diff_complect .card .card-body {
        flex-direction: column;
    }
    .content .catalog-content  .card-group-list-img .card-group-product .diff_complect .card .card-body .action {
        width: 35%;
    }
    .content .catalog-content  .card-group-list-img .card-group-product .diff_complect .card .card-body .diff_prices .diff_comparator {
        width: unset;
    }
    .content .catalog-content  .card-group-list-img .card-group-product .diff_complect .card .card-body .card-discription {
        width: 100%
    }

    .content .catalog-content  .card-group-list-img .card-group-product .diff_complect .card .card-body .card-text-center {
        width: 100%
    }

    .content .catalog-content  .card-group-list-img .card-group-product .diff_complect .card .card-body .diff_prices{
        justify-content: space-between;
    }
}